Impact of anabolic androgenic steroids on male sexual and reproductive function: a systematic review

Massimiliano Esposito et al.

Summary: AAS abuse has negative effects on the male reproductive organs, causing testicular atrophy and azoospermia. Although sperm quality can recover within a few months after stopping AAS abuse, the impact on spermatogenesis may take up to three years to disappear. There is a positive correlation between AAS abuse and an increase in morphologically abnormal spermatozoa in athletes.

Automated online dried blood spot sample preparation and detection of anabolic steroid esters for sports drug testing

Jing Jing et al.

Summary: Dried blood spots (DBS) are a valuable sample matrix for routine doping analysis, and a fully automated online DBS preparation and detection method has been developed and validated for screening and quantification of anabolic steroid esters. The method showed linear, precise, and accurate results, with applicable LODs for testosterone laurate and other steroid esters. Analyte stability evaluation demonstrated the applicability of automated DBS analysis in doping control for detection of anabolic steroid esters.

Dried blood spots for anti-doping: Why just going volumetric may not be sufficient

Marc Luginbuhl et al.

Summary: This perspective discusses quantitative DBS analysis for anti-doping testing in an athletic population and argues that using only volumetric sampling may not be sufficient. It provides examples of HCT variations, discusses the whole blood to plasma ratio and HCT extraction bias, and presents options to correct for the HCT bias.

Improving the detection of anabolic steroid esters in human serum by LC-MS

Xavier de la Torre et al.

Summary: This article introduces an analytical method for detecting testosterone and nandrolone esters in human serum, involving sample pre-treatment, derivatization, and validation. The Girard P hydrazones derivative was found to be the most effective. The method is specific for all compounds considered, linear within the investigated concentration range, with LODs ranging from 0.03 to 0.30 ng/mL, high extraction recovery, and minimal matrix effect.
